英文摘要
The Canadian digital economy is booming and outpaces the overall economy 4 to 1 in job growth over the past two years. Software development comprises a crucial part of this sector. Being able to develop correct, reliable, and scalable software is critical for all modern systems, regardless of their intended domain of application.
Unfortunately, software development is hard. Empirical studies have shown that developers have to perform a broad variety of complex tasks while they work. To successfully complete these tasks, developers often have to perform several steps, combine many disparate sources of information, and use multiple tools and applications into complex workflows.
Most research supporting software developers predominantly focuses on supporting specific development activities, such as coding, code search, or testing. Surprisingly little is known about the overall series of steps and activities that developers combine into the complex workflows they have to perform to accomplish their higher level tasks and objectives on a day-to-day basis.
By building a better understanding of these workflows, we aim to help developers contribute to the economy by supporting them in completing their tasks more quickly and with higher quality. We will do this through extensive empirical studies with our industrial partner which we will use to propose novel tools improving common develop workflows. We will evaluate the utility of these new tools in the industrial workplace and ultimately hope this work will provide a principled understanding for how developers work so we can better support them as they perform complex technical workflows.
